About Laval-sur-le-Lac, Quebec

Laval-sur-le-Lac is a administrative sector in Laval; Laval, Quebec, Canada. It is classified as a village / hamlet. Laval-sur-le-Lac is located at 45.5333°N, 73.8667°W.

Laval-sur-le-Lac occupies a serene stretch of land defined by the expansive waters of Lac des Deux Montagnes and the quiet flow of the Rivière du Chêne. It lies 20.3 km east-north-east of Kanesatake, QC (from Kanesatake, QC: bearing 74°T), and is situated 9.7 km west-south-west of Laval. Laval-sur-le-Lac maintains a distinct character, marked by its history as an enclave of privacy and exclusive residential life. The local economy and daily atmosphere are shaped by this quietude, favoring a lifestyle that prioritizes the natural geography over the dense industrial sprawl found elsewhere in the region. Residents move through their days with a deliberate calmness, often defined by the seasonal shifts that transform the icy expanse of the lake into a mirror for the winter sky. Notable for its prestigious golf course, which has drawn prominent figures in politics and sports over the decades, Laval-sur-le-Lac preserves a reputation for refined seclusion.
